Use the explicit formula to find the 41st term of the sequence, 10,4,-2,-8 GIVING 65 POINTS

What we know here is that the pattern subtracts 6 every nth value progression.

We can create a explicit formula for this sequence.

let the output be f(n)

let term # = n

so the formula would be...

f(n)=10-6(n-1)

If we plug in the value 41 for n

f(n)=10-6(41-1)\\f(n)=10-6(40)\\f(n)=10-240\\f(n)=-230


41st term of the sequence is -230
